Accounts Assistant - Accountancy Practice Our client is a fast growing owner-managed modern accountancy firm which specialises in business advisory work and tax planning. They strongly believe in the principle of going above and beyond for their clients, and are based in a beautiful parkland setting in Midlothian, on the outskirts of Edinburgh. They are looking to recruit an accountancy professional who is able to work with little to no supervision and would welcome the opportunity to develop their own position within the business. If you are frustrated by your current work situation and are looking for a role with more responsibility and flexibility, then they would like to hear from you. Why should you apply for the role? Opportunity to develop your career Have flexibility with work hours and the opportunity to work from home occasionally Be part of a friendly, client focused environment Work in beautiful surroundings General Duties: Preparation of accounts for sole-traders, partnerships and limited companies Bookkeeping and VAT return preparation and review Tax return preparation Payroll experience helpful but not essential Reporting to the Client Manager Minimum Requirements A minimum of 1 years general practice experience, preparing accounts for a wide variety of clients Ideally qualified/part-qualified AAT Confident approach to develop client relationships and build rapport with the team Ability to work unsupervised Experience of using bookkeeping packages such as FreeAgent and Xero Great attention to detail, pro-active and organised A commitment to getting the job done A high level of empathy and a sense of humour Salary Range: Your salary package will start in the range £19,000 - £24,000 per annum (depending on qualifications and experience) Hours: 35 hours per week flexible working with core hours 10am-3.30pm and the ability to work from home occasionally Holidays: Generous 6 weeks as well as bank holidays Please note that you will be required to apply via the company's own application portal and this will include a couple of questionnaires which will take approximately 20 minutes to complete.
